具有功能參數(shù)設(shè)定的方法與應(yīng)用其的集成電路的制作方法
【技術(shù)領(lǐng)域】
[0001]本發(fā)明是有關(guān)于一種功能參數(shù)設(shè)定的技術(shù),尤指一種具有功能參數(shù)設(shè)定的方法與應(yīng)用其的集成電路。
【背景技術(shù)】
[0002]在啟動(dòng)集成電路時(shí),通常通過連接至集成電路的功能引腳的硬件來獲得初始設(shè)定值。例如,在常見的分壓設(shè)定法中,至少使用兩個(gè)電阻器,且以分壓方式來設(shè)定初始設(shè)定值時(shí)。集成電路通過其功能引腳來檢測(cè)出分壓的百分比,從而獲得設(shè)定值。
[0003]另一現(xiàn)有技術(shù)為并聯(lián)電阻設(shè)定法。在并聯(lián)電阻設(shè)定法中,從功能引腳流入或流出一個(gè)固定的檢測(cè)電流,以在功能引腳處形成電壓檢測(cè)值,藉以檢測(cè)并聯(lián)的電阻值的設(shè)定區(qū)間。分壓設(shè)定法對(duì)于設(shè)定區(qū)間的檢測(cè)精準(zhǔn)度通常會(huì)比并聯(lián)電阻設(shè)定法高。但是,如果使用并聯(lián)電阻設(shè)定法來檢測(cè)電阻值設(shè)定區(qū)間,則相對(duì)地就得犧牲一些用在分壓設(shè)定法的電阻值設(shè)定區(qū)間。若現(xiàn)有技術(shù)兼用兩種設(shè)定法則勢(shì)必會(huì)犧牲一些電阻值設(shè)定區(qū)間。
[0004]此外,并聯(lián)電阻設(shè)定法所用的檢測(cè)電流局限于特定的范圍,且進(jìn)行檢測(cè)所采用的比較器也存在相應(yīng)的偏差值和其他的設(shè)計(jì)誤差因數(shù)。在設(shè)計(jì)安全的顧慮下,并聯(lián)電阻值愈大的設(shè)定區(qū)間,其相鄰兩設(shè)定區(qū)間的并聯(lián)電阻設(shè)定值會(huì)相距愈大。因此,現(xiàn)有技術(shù)的并聯(lián)電阻設(shè)定法所能使用的設(shè)定區(qū)間范圍實(shí)在有限。
[0005]此外,并聯(lián)電阻設(shè)定法中的退化電路的特例形式如下,功能引腳只連接一個(gè)電阻的一端,且該電阻的另一端連接地或某電源。
【發(fā)明內(nèi)容】
[0006]有鑒于此,本發(fā)明提出一種具有功能參數(shù)設(shè)定的方法與應(yīng)用其的集成電路,藉以解決現(xiàn)有技術(shù)所涉及的問題。
[0007]本發(fā)明提出一種具有功能參數(shù)設(shè)定的集成電路,耦接外部設(shè)定單元。集成電路包括功能引腳、切換單元以及功能調(diào)整電路。功能引腳耦接外部設(shè)定單元。切換單元耦接功能引腳。功能調(diào)整電路耦接切換單元。功能調(diào)整電路包括第一電流源與第二電流源。第一電流源與第二電流源分別耦接切換單元。功能調(diào)整電路利用第一電流源來檢測(cè)功能引腳上的第一電壓檢測(cè)值,比較第一電壓檢測(cè)值與預(yù)設(shè)值。切換單元根據(jù)比較結(jié)果切換第一電流源與第二電流源。
[0008]在本發(fā)明的一實(shí)施例中,功能調(diào)整電路還包括控制單元??刂茊卧鶕?jù)第一電壓檢測(cè)值與預(yù)設(shè)值來產(chǎn)生比較結(jié)果。當(dāng)比較結(jié)果表示第一電壓檢測(cè)值小于預(yù)設(shè)值時(shí),則控制切換單元導(dǎo)通第一電流源與外部設(shè)定單元之間的路徑;當(dāng)?shù)谝浑妷簷z測(cè)值大于預(yù)設(shè)值時(shí),則控制切換單元導(dǎo)通第二電流源與外部設(shè)定單元之間的路徑。
[0009]在本發(fā)明的一實(shí)施例中,功能調(diào)整電路還包括第一邏輯單元以及第二邏輯單元。第一邏輯單元具有第一組多個(gè)比較器,第二邏輯單元具有第二組至少一個(gè)比較器。當(dāng)?shù)谝浑妷簷z測(cè)值小于預(yù)設(shè)值時(shí),控制單元啟動(dòng)第一邏輯單元,第一邏輯單元根據(jù)第一電壓檢測(cè)值來判斷外部設(shè)定單元對(duì)應(yīng)的電阻值設(shè)定區(qū)間,并且設(shè)定功能參數(shù)。當(dāng)?shù)谝浑妷簷z測(cè)值大于預(yù)設(shè)值時(shí),控制單元啟動(dòng)第二邏輯單元,功能調(diào)整電路利用第二電流源來檢測(cè)功能引腳上的第二電壓檢測(cè)值,并且第二邏輯單元根據(jù)第二電壓檢測(cè)值來判斷外部設(shè)定單元對(duì)應(yīng)的電阻值設(shè)定區(qū)間,并且設(shè)定功能參數(shù)。
[0010]在本發(fā)明的一實(shí)施例中,第一電流源的電流值大于第二電流源的電流值。
[0011]本發(fā)明還提出一種具有功能參數(shù)設(shè)定的集成電路,耦接外部設(shè)定單元。集成電路包括功能引腳、切換單元、第一功能調(diào)整電路以及第二功能調(diào)整電路。功能引腳耦接外部設(shè)定單元。切換單元耦接功能引腳。第一功能調(diào)整電路耦接切換單元且接收參考值。第一功能調(diào)整電路包括第一電流源與第二電流源。第一電流源與第二電流源分別耦接切換單元。第二功能調(diào)整電路耦接切換單元。第二功能調(diào)整電路檢測(cè)功能引腳上的分壓的百分比,據(jù)以提供參考值,并且設(shè)定第二功能參數(shù)。第一功能調(diào)整電路利用第一電流源來檢測(cè)功能引腳上的第一電壓檢測(cè)值,比較第一電壓檢測(cè)值與預(yù)設(shè)值以產(chǎn)生一比較結(jié)果,并以比較結(jié)果控制切換單元來切換第一電流源與第二電流源,并且設(shè)定第一功能參數(shù)。
[0012]在本發(fā)明的一實(shí)施例中,第一功能調(diào)整電路還包括控制單元。控制單元根據(jù)第一電壓檢測(cè)值與預(yù)設(shè)值來產(chǎn)生比較結(jié)果。當(dāng)比較結(jié)果表示第一電壓檢測(cè)值小于預(yù)設(shè)值時(shí),則控制切換單元導(dǎo)通第一電流源與外部設(shè)定單元之間的路徑;當(dāng)?shù)谝浑妷簷z測(cè)值大于預(yù)設(shè)值時(shí),則控制切換單元導(dǎo)通第二電流源與外部設(shè)定單元之間的路徑。
[0013]在本發(fā)明的一實(shí)施例中,第一功能調(diào)整電路還包括第一邏輯單元以及第二邏輯單元。第一邏輯單元具有第一組多個(gè)比較器。第二邏輯單元具有第二組至少一個(gè)比較器。當(dāng)?shù)谝浑妷簷z測(cè)值小于預(yù)設(shè)值時(shí),控制單元啟動(dòng)第一邏輯單元,第一邏輯單元根據(jù)第一電壓檢測(cè)值與參考值來判斷外部設(shè)定單元對(duì)應(yīng)的電阻值設(shè)定區(qū)間,并且設(shè)定第一功能參數(shù)。當(dāng)電壓檢測(cè)值大于預(yù)設(shè)值時(shí),控制單元啟動(dòng)第二邏輯單元,第一功能調(diào)整電路利用第二電流源來檢測(cè)功能引腳上的第二電壓檢測(cè)值,并且第二邏輯單元根據(jù)第二電壓檢測(cè)值與參考值來判斷外部設(shè)定單元對(duì)應(yīng)的電阻值設(shè)定區(qū)間,并且設(shè)定第一功能參數(shù)。
[0014]在本發(fā)明的一實(shí)施例中,切換單元斷開第一電流源與第二電流源與外部設(shè)定單元之間的路徑,并且以第二功能調(diào)整電路進(jìn)行第二功能參數(shù)的設(shè)定。
[0015]本發(fā)明還提出一種具有功能參數(shù)設(shè)定的方法,用于集成電路。集成電路具有功能引腳。功能引腳耦接外部設(shè)定單元與切換單元。所述方法包括下列步驟:提供功能調(diào)整電路,功能調(diào)整電路包括第一電流源與第二電流源,分別耦接切換單元;將第一電流源經(jīng)由功能引腳流入或流出外部設(shè)定單元;通過功能調(diào)整電路檢測(cè)功能引腳上的第一電壓檢測(cè)值;根據(jù)第一電壓檢測(cè)值與預(yù)設(shè)值產(chǎn)生比較結(jié)果;以及通過比較結(jié)果控制切換單元來切換第一電流源與第二電流源。
[0016]在本發(fā)明的一實(shí)施例中,具有功能參數(shù)設(shè)定的方法還包括:當(dāng)比較結(jié)果表示第一電壓檢測(cè)值小于預(yù)設(shè)值時(shí),則控制切換單元導(dǎo)通第一電流源、功能引腳與外部設(shè)定單元之間的路徑;當(dāng)?shù)谝浑妷簷z測(cè)值大于預(yù)設(shè)值時(shí),則控制切換單元導(dǎo)通第二電流源、功能引腳與外部設(shè)定單元之間的路徑。
[0017]在本發(fā)明的一實(shí)施例中,功能調(diào)整電路還包括第一邏輯單元與第二邏輯單元,所述方法還包括:當(dāng)?shù)谝浑妷簷z測(cè)值小于預(yù)設(shè)值時(shí),啟動(dòng)第一邏輯單元,第一邏輯單元根據(jù)第一電壓檢測(cè)值來判斷外部設(shè)定單元對(duì)應(yīng)的電阻值設(shè)定區(qū)間,并且設(shè)定功能參數(shù);以及當(dāng)?shù)谝浑妷簷z測(cè)值大于預(yù)設(shè)值時(shí),啟動(dòng)第二邏輯單元,將第二電流源經(jīng)由功能引腳流入或流出夕卜部設(shè)定單元,檢測(cè)功能引腳上的第二電壓檢測(cè)值,第二邏輯單元根據(jù)第二電壓檢測(cè)值來判斷外部設(shè)定單元對(duì)應(yīng)的電阻值設(shè)定區(qū)間,并且設(shè)定功能參數(shù)。
[0018]本發(fā)明還提出一種具有功能參數(shù)設(shè)定的方法,用于集成電路。集成電路具有功能引腳。功能引腳耦接外部設(shè)定單元與切換單元。所述方法包括下列步驟:提供第一功能調(diào)整電路與第二功能調(diào)整電路,分別耦接切換單元,第一功能調(diào)整電路包括第一電流源與第二電流源;通過第二功能調(diào)整電路檢測(cè)功能引腳上的分壓的百分比,據(jù)以提供參考值至第一功能調(diào)整電路,并且設(shè)定第二功能參數(shù);將第一電流源經(jīng)由功能引腳流入或流出外部設(shè)定單元;通過第一功能調(diào)整電路檢測(cè)外部設(shè)定單元的第一電壓檢測(cè)值;根據(jù)第一電壓檢測(cè)值與預(yù)設(shè)值產(chǎn)生比較結(jié)果;以及通過比較結(jié)果控制切換單元來切換第一電流源與第二電流源。
[0019]在本發(fā)明的一實(shí)施例中,具有功能參數(shù)設(shè)定的方法還包括:當(dāng)比較結(jié)果表示第一電壓檢測(cè)值小于預(yù)設(shè)值時(shí),則控制切換單元導(dǎo)通第一電流源、功能引腳與外部設(shè)定單元之間的路徑;當(dāng)?shù)谝浑妷簷z測(cè)值大于預(yù)設(shè)值時(shí),則控制切換單元導(dǎo)通第二電流源、功能引腳與外部設(shè)定單元之間的路徑。
[0020]在本發(fā)明的一實(shí)施例中,第一功能調(diào)整電路還包括第一邏輯單元與第二邏輯單元。所述方法還包括:當(dāng)?shù)谝浑妷簷z測(cè)值小于預(yù)設(shè)值時(shí),啟動(dòng)第一邏輯單元,第一邏輯單元根據(jù)第一電壓檢測(cè)值與參考值來判斷外部設(shè)定單元對(duì)應(yīng)的電阻值設(shè)定區(qū)間,并且設(shè)定第一功能參數(shù);以及當(dāng)?shù)谝浑妷簷z測(cè)值大于預(yù)設(shè)值時(shí),啟動(dòng)第二邏輯單元,將第二電流源經(jīng)由功能引腳流入或流出外部設(shè)定單元,檢測(cè)功能引腳上的第二電壓檢測(cè)值,第二邏輯單元根據(jù)第二電壓檢測(cè)值與參考值來判斷外部設(shè)定單元對(duì)應(yīng)的電阻值設(shè)定區(qū)間,并且設(shè)定第一功能參數(shù)。
[0021]基于上述,功能參數(shù)設(shè)定的方法與應(yīng)用其的集成電路采用一種具有切換多個(gè)電流源和檢測(cè)的集成電路,擴(kuò)展了電阻值設(shè)定區(qū)間的范圍。相較于現(xiàn)有技術(shù),本發(fā)明在進(jìn)行并聯(lián)電阻設(shè)定法時(shí),可以檢測(cè)出較多的電阻值設(shè)定區(qū)間,因此可設(shè)定的電阻值范圍更大。另一方面,本發(fā)明的集成電路可以在同一個(gè)功能引腳進(jìn)行多功能參數(shù)設(shè)定,在執(zhí)行分壓設(shè)定法時(shí)可以維持檢測(cè)精準(zhǔn)度,并且在執(zhí)行并聯(lián)設(shè)定法時(shí)也不會(huì)犧牲一些用在分壓設(shè)定法的電阻值設(shè)定區(qū)間,因此兼具兩種設(shè)定法的優(yōu)點(diǎn)。
[0022]應(yīng)了解的是,上述一般描述及以下【具體實(shí)施方式】僅為例示性及闡釋性的,其并不能限制本發(fā)明所欲主張的范圍。
【附圖說明】
[0023]下面的附圖是本發(fā)明的說明書的一部分,其示出了本發(fā)明的示例實(shí)施例,附圖與說明書的描述一起用來說明本發(fā)明的原理;